%0 Journal Article %T Clinical and Laboratory Evidence for Probiotic-Releasing Denture Base Materials (Devices): Viability, Antibiofilm Effect and Clinical Outcomes %A Zeeshan Qamar %A Hajar Ayed Nazzal Alsulaili %A Amal Ghazi Dwilan Almutairi %A Yasamin Abdullah Hussain Almuteb %J Turkish Journal of Public Health Dentistry %@ 3062-3359 %D 2026 %V 6 %N 2 %R 10.51847/SKnwmWuzcH %P 13-21 %X A frequent inflammatory disease in denture wearers is denture stomatitis, which is closely linked with the colonization of denture surfaces with Candida species, in particular, Candida albicans. Denture materials give the optimal microbial adhesion and biofilm formation site which may cause long-term infections and mucosal inflammation. Traditional antifungal therapies can help alleviate symptoms but the reoccurrence of the fungal infection is common because of the biofilm resistance and microbial disproportion in the mouth. Most recently, probiotics are suggested as an attractive alternative control measure of fungal colonization and oral microbial balance. This systematic review sought to determine clinical and laboratory evidence on the usefulness of probiotic-based interventions in the management of Candida biofilms in denture materials and denture wearers. The review was studied according to the PRISMA 2020 principles. PubMed, Scopus, Web of Science, and Google Scholar were searched thoroughly to reveal studies that were published since 2019. Following the elimination of duplicates and sifting of titles and abstracts, 40 full-text articles were evaluated to be eligible. Lastly, 20 articles passed the inclusion criteria and were incorporated in the systematic review. The studies included were randomized clinical trials, observational clinical studies and laboratory studies assessing probiotic strains of Lactobacillus rhamnosus, Limosilactobacillus reuteri, and multispecies pro-biotic formulations. Laboratory experiments showed that probiotics have the ability to prevent Candida adhesion, interfere with biofilm formation on denture surfaces, and clinical experiments have shown a decrease in Candida colonization and improvement in the symptoms of denture stomatitis. The research results indicate that probiotic-based interventions can offer positive results in the treatment of denture-associated fungal infections. But, to establish the effectiveness and safety of probiotic measures in denture management over the long run, further large-scale clinical trials with standard protocols are needed. %U https://tjphd.com/article/clinical-and-laboratory-evidence-for-probiotic-releasing-denture-base-materials-devices-viability-ouwotjo8bdbhzad
